CIA nominee John Brennan defends drone strikes

CIA director nominee John Brennan has defended the US drone-strikes programme at a Senate confirmation hearing.

Mr Brennan said the US only took such action as a last resort and was careful to prevent civilian deaths.

[font size=1]-snip-[/font]

During later questions, Mr Brennan said some Americans believe that strikes are used to punish for past transgressions.

"Nothing could be further from the truth," he said. "We only take such actions as a last resort to save lives when there's no other alternative to taking an action that's going to mitigate that threat."
